Harbor Point Behavioral Health Center offers hope and healing for youth ages 7 to 17 at the time of admission with several psychiatric diagnoses and/or developmental disabilities. Located in Portsmouth, VA, Harbor Point provides intensive, residential treatment to youth in a comfortable setting that is conducive to healing. Our facility specializes in treating children and adolescents with depression, bipolar, ADHD, and other mental health issues. We also have specific treatment programs for those with intellectual disabilities or those with self‑injurious behavior. Harbor Point and its programs are fully accredited by The Joint Commission and the Virginia Association of Independent Specialized Educational Facilities. We are licensed by The Virginia Department of Behavioral Health and Developmental Services and the Virginia Department of Education. We are a TRICARE‑approved and certified facility.
Registered Nurse Supervisor is responsible for planning, directing, implementing, and evaluating all aspects of nursing care in an assigned unit for residents ages 07‑18. Adheres to Nursing Standards and Policies, Facility Policies and Procedures, the Nurse Practice Act, and maintains patient safety.
